          @badastro Sadly I think the #ClimateCrisis is already so bad if you understand that a lot of what we have already done will continue to have increasing effects over a large number of future years that we will now almost certainly need to use large scale #Geoengineering just to try to keep major areas of human habitation inhabitable. Neal Stephenson's Novel "Termination Shock" explores the concept & consequences of the particles in the atmosphere(& if you are very cynical like me assume is current plan of the fossil fuel companies as they have the piles of sulphur ready ) idea well. I agree with you that this is likely to have a lot of unforeseen effects some of which could cause even more unstable global tensions. For what it is worth when the governments of the world are forced to take action due to the increasingly high body count of the #ClimateCrisis I would go for a #Space mirror/s at Lagrange 1(if it could be dual use for a large space telescope🔭 all the better as we could have nice pics to look at whilst not burning to a crisp😜 ) as it would be much easier to remove/move a mirror than sulphur particles spread across al the Earths atmosphere.(And would not necessarily further enrich fossil fuel companies patching the consequences of their prior actions‼️ )
